Being tagged in an Instagram photo is akin to a public endorsement of that moment. However, when the content doesn’t resonate with you, removing the tag becomes essential. Here’s a step-by-step guide to reclaiming control over your Instagram tags:

  • Open your Instagram app on your smartphone – this feature is accessible only through the app.
  • Head to your profile by tapping your avatar, then select the tagged photos icon.
  • Here, you’ll find all the images you’re tagged in, browse to find the one you wish to untag from.
  • Tap the photo to open it, tap your username in the tag, and then select ‘Remove Me From Post’.
  • Confirm your decision to untag yourself by selecting “Yes, I’m sure.”

Performing these steps will seamlessly untag you from the photo, helping maintain your desired Instagram identity.

FAQ

Q: What’s the consequence of untagging myself from an Instagram photo?

A: Untagging yourself simply removes the tag; the photo will no longer appear in the ‘Photos of You’ section on your profile, but it remains on the poster’s account.

Q: Can I prevent users from tagging me in the future?

A: You can adjust your account settings to review tags before they appear on your profile. Under ‘Settings’, look for ‘Tags’ and select ‘Add Manually’ for better control over tags.
